Shares of REVG.N declined sharply today, reaching a 20-day low as investors reacted to broader market volatility. The stock's recent performance indicates a bearish trend, with the price breaking below this critical technical level, signaling increased selling pressure. Analysts suggest that the downturn may be attributed to recent economic data releases that have raised concerns about consumer spending and overall market stability. As investors reassess their positions, REVG.N's decline reflects a cautious sentiment prevailing in the market.
Analyst Views on REVG
Wall Street analysts forecast REVG stock price to fall over the next 12 months. According to Wall Street analysts, the average 1-year price target for REVG is 61.00 USD with a low forecast of 55.00 USD and a high forecast of 71.00 USD. However, analyst price targets are subjective and often lag stock prices, so investors should focus on the objective reasons behind analyst rating changes, which better reflect the company's fundamentals.

About REVG
REV Group, Inc. is a designer, manufacturer, and distributor of specialty vehicles and related aftermarket parts and services, serving a diversified customer base, primarily in the North America. The Company's segments include Specialty Vehicles and Recreational Vehicles. The Specialty Vehicles segment sells fire apparatus equipment under the E-ONE, KME, and Ferrara brands, and Spartan ER, which consists of the Spartan Emergency Response, Smeal, Spartan Fire Chassis, and Ladder Tower brands, ambulances under the AEV, Horton, Leader, Road Rescue and Wheeled Coach brands, and terminal trucks and sweepers under the Capacity and Laymor brands, respectively. The Recreational Vehicles segment serves the RV market through brands, such as American Coach, Fleetwood RV, Holiday Rambler, Renegade RV, and Midwest Automotive Designs. The Company’s products in the segment include Class A motorized RVs, Class C and Super C motorized RVs, Class B RVs, and towable travel trailers and truck campers.
